博客 云资源成本优化:弹性伸缩与负载均衡的高效策略

云资源成本优化:弹性伸缩与负载均衡的高效策略

   数栈君   发表于 2026-03-01 20:25  48  0

在数字化转型的浪潮中,企业对云资源的需求日益增长,但随之而来的云资源成本也在不断增加。如何在保证系统性能的同时,实现云资源成本的优化,成为企业关注的焦点。弹性伸缩(Auto Scaling)和负载均衡(Load Balancing)作为云计算中的两大核心技术,能够有效帮助企业降低云资源成本,提升系统性能和稳定性。本文将深入探讨弹性伸缩与负载均衡的高效策略,为企业提供实用的优化方案。


一、弹性伸缩:动态调整资源,降低浪费

弹性伸缩是一种根据应用负载变化自动调整计算资源容量的机制。通过弹性伸缩,企业可以根据实际需求灵活扩展或缩减云服务器的数量,从而避免资源浪费和性能瓶颈。

1. 弹性伸缩的核心机制

弹性伸缩的核心在于“自动调整”。它通过监控应用的负载指标(如CPU使用率、内存使用率、网络流量等),自动触发伸缩操作。当负载增加时,系统会自动创建新的云服务器实例;当负载降低时,会自动销毁多余的实例。这种动态调整能够确保资源始终与需求匹配,避免资源闲置或超配。

2. 弹性伸缩的伸缩策略

企业在使用弹性伸缩时,需要根据业务特点制定合理的伸缩策略:

  • 基于指标的伸缩:根据CPU使用率、内存使用率等指标触发伸缩操作。例如,当CPU使用率持续高于80%时,自动增加实例数量;当CPU使用率低于30%时,自动减少实例数量。
  • 预测性伸缩:通过历史数据和预测模型,预判负载变化趋势,提前调整资源。例如,在预测到即将到来的流量高峰时,提前扩容。
  • 时间基伸缩:根据业务的周期性特点,设置固定的伸缩计划。例如,在每天的特定时间段自动增加实例数量。

3. 弹性伸缩的优势

  • 降低成本:避免资源闲置或超配,按需使用,节省成本。
  • 提升性能:自动调整资源,确保系统始终运行在最佳性能状态。
  • 简化管理:自动化操作减少人工干预,降低运维复杂度。

二、负载均衡:分担压力,提升可用性

负载均衡是一种将流量分发到多台服务器的技术,能够提高应用的可用性和响应速度。通过负载均衡,企业可以将高并发的流量均匀分配到多台服务器上,避免单点故障和性能瓶颈。

1. 负载均衡的工作原理

负载均衡通过健康检查(如HTTP健康检查、TCP健康检查)监控后端服务器的状态,自动将流量分发到可用的服务器上。如果某台服务器出现故障,负载均衡会自动将其从流量分发中移除,并将流量分配到其他健康的服务器上。

2. 常见的负载均衡算法

  • 轮询算法(Round Robin):按顺序将流量分发到每台服务器,确保流量均匀分布。
  • 最少连接算法(Least Connections):将流量分发到当前连接数最少的服务器,适合长连接场景。
  • 加权轮询算法(Weighted Round Robin):根据服务器的权重(如CPU、内存资源)分配流量,确保资源丰富的服务器承担更多流量。

3. 负载均衡的优势

  • 提升可用性:通过多台服务器分担流量,避免单点故障。
  • 提高性能:均匀分配流量,避免某台服务器过载。
  • 简化架构:通过负载均衡,企业可以更轻松地扩展系统规模。

三、弹性伸缩与负载均衡的结合:优化资源利用

弹性伸缩和负载均衡是相辅相成的,结合使用能够进一步优化资源利用,降低成本。

1. 动态扩展能力

通过弹性伸缩,企业可以根据负载变化自动调整服务器数量,而负载均衡则负责将流量均匀分配到这些服务器上。这种结合能够确保在流量高峰时快速扩容,避免性能瓶颈;在流量低谷时自动缩容,节省成本。

2. 提高系统稳定性

负载均衡能够确保流量均匀分布,避免某台服务器过载,而弹性伸缩则能够根据负载变化自动调整资源。这种结合能够提高系统的稳定性和可靠性,减少故障发生率。

3. 降低运营成本

通过弹性伸缩和负载均衡的结合,企业可以按需使用资源,避免资源闲置或超配,从而降低运营成本。


四、云资源成本优化的实用策略

除了弹性伸缩和负载均衡,企业还可以采取以下策略进一步优化云资源成本:

1. 合理选择云服务提供商

不同云服务提供商的价格和服务质量有所不同,企业应根据自身需求选择性价比最高的云服务提供商。

2. 合理设置伸缩参数

在设置弹性伸缩的触发条件和冷却时间时,应根据业务特点进行合理配置,避免频繁的伸缩操作导致成本增加。

3. 监控与日志分析

通过监控工具(如云监控、Prometheus等)实时监控系统负载和资源使用情况,并通过日志分析优化资源配置。

4. 使用自动化工具

通过自动化工具(如Ansible、Terraform等)实现资源的自动化管理,进一步提升效率。


五、案例分析:弹性伸缩与负载均衡的实际应用

以一家电商网站为例,该网站在促销活动期间流量激增,传统的固定资源配置难以应对高并发请求,导致系统崩溃。通过引入弹性伸缩和负载均衡,该网站在促销期间能够自动扩容,将流量均匀分配到多台服务器上,确保系统稳定运行,同时节省了大量成本。


六、结论

弹性伸缩和负载均衡是实现云资源成本优化的两大核心技术。通过弹性伸缩,企业可以根据负载变化自动调整资源,避免资源浪费;通过负载均衡,企业可以将流量均匀分配到多台服务器上,提高系统性能和稳定性。结合使用这两种技术,企业可以进一步优化资源利用,降低成本,提升竞争力。

如果您对弹性伸缩和负载均衡感兴趣,可以申请试用相关服务,了解更多详细信息:申请试用

申请试用&下载资料
点击袋鼠云官网申请免费试用:https://www.dtstack.com/?src=bbs
点击袋鼠云资料中心免费下载干货资料:https://www.dtstack.com/resources/?src=bbs
《数据资产管理白皮书》下载地址:https://www.dtstack.com/resources/1073/?src=bbs
《行业指标体系白皮书》下载地址:https://www.dtstack.com/resources/1057/?src=bbs
《数据治理行业实践白皮书》下载地址:https://www.dtstack.com/resources/1001/?src=bbs
《数栈V6.0产品白皮书》下载地址:https://www.dtstack.com/resources/1004/?src=bbs

免责声明
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,袋鼠云不对内容的真实、准确或完整作任何形式的承诺。如有其他问题,您可以通过联系400-002-1024进行反馈,袋鼠云收到您的反馈后将及时答复和处理。
0条评论
社区公告
  • 大数据领域最专业的产品&技术交流社区,专注于探讨与分享大数据领域有趣又火热的信息,专业又专注的数据人园地

最新活动更多
微信扫码获取数字化转型资料